There are 12000 people directly employed by the 20 Premier League clubs while in 201617 the League supported almost 100000 full-time equivalent jobs across the UK according to the report. EYs Economic and Social Impact Assessment also found that the League contributed 76billion to the UKs Gross Domestic Product estimated through the Gross Value Added GVA it generates.

With matches suspended due Covid-19 clubs across the continent are facing steep losses of income and seeking to cut costs. Some clubs I fear will get very close to bankruptcy if it proves impossible to resume the calendar by late spring or early summer.
